Abstract

The utility model discloses a kind of molds, including supporting body and more than one micro-structure being set on the supporting body one side, the micro-structure is bulge-structure and/or concave structure, in on the thickness direction of the supporting body, one end face of the micro-structure is polygon, other end is arc-shaped curved surface, and the peripheral part of the peripheral part of the polygon and the arc-shaped curved surface is around connection.A kind of decorating film and electronic equipment cover board is also disclosed in the utility model.One end face of the micro-structure of the utility model, micro-structure is polygon, and other end is arc-shaped curved surface, and the peripheral part of the peripheral part of the polygon and the arc-shaped curved surface is around connection.Decorating film has the effect of shadow of taper, while the shadow presented has frosted finish effect.The color of decorating film is more gorgeous changeable and agile full, to form visual effect abundant, can achieve good decorative effect and aesthetics.

Below by way of several embodiments and the technical solution of the utility model is further described in conjunction with attached drawing.However, Selected embodiment is merely to illustrate the utility model, without limiting the scope of the utility model.
It please refers to shown in FIG. 1 to FIG. 3, in the first embodiment of the utility model, mold includes supporting body and is set to institute More than one micro-structure on supporting body one side is stated, the micro-structure is bulge-structure and/or concave structure.
One end face 10 of micro-structure 1 is rectangle, and other end is arc-shaped curved surface 11, the peripheral part and arc-shaped curved surface 11 of rectangle Peripheral part around connection.The top of the arc-shaped curved surface 11 is located at the maximum inscribed circle radius of rectangle in the orthographic projection of rectangle 2/3rds with inner region.
Wherein, the top of arc-shaped curved surface 11 can be located at the center of rectangle in the orthographic projection of rectangle.
It please refers to shown in Fig. 4~Fig. 5, the decorating film 2 in the present embodiment, including substrate layer 22 and is set to the substrate layer Optical structure layers on 22 one sides, the optical structure layers include more than one optical microstructures 21, the micro- knot of optics Structure 21 is bulge-structure and/or concave structure, on the thickness direction of the decorating film, an end face of the optical microstructures 21 For rectangle, other end is arc-shaped curved surface, and the peripheral part of the peripheral part of the rectangle and the arc-shaped curved surface is around connection.
Micro-structure 21 is distributed in array spacings, in other embodiments, can also be micro- with random distribution or continuously distributed Structure 21 is formed using photoresist.
For example, decorating film 2 includes substrate layer 22, several micro-structures 21 are set to the first surface of substrate layer 22, micro-structure It is rendered as bulge-structure.
It please refers to shown in Fig. 6~Fig. 8, in the second embodiment of the utility model, mold includes supporting body and is set to More than one micro-structure 3 on the supporting body one side, the micro-structure 3 are bulge-structure and/or concave structure.
One end face 30 of micro-structure 3 is triangle, and other end is arc-shaped curved surface 31, and the peripheral part and arc of triangle are bent The peripheral part in face 31 is around connection.The top of the arc-shaped curved surface 31 is inscribed in the maximum that the orthographic projection of triangle is located at triangle 2/3rds of radius of circle are with inner region.
Wherein, the top of arc-shaped curved surface 31 can be located at the center of triangle in the orthographic projection of triangle.
Decorating film in the present embodiment, including substrate layer and the optical structure layers that are set on the substrate layer one side, The optical structure layers include more than one optical microstructures 3, and the optical microstructures are bulge-structure and/or concave knot Structure, on the thickness direction of the decorating film, an end face of the optical microstructures 3 is triangle, and other end is that arc is bent The peripheral part of face, the peripheral part of the triangle and the arc-shaped curved surface is around connection.
Micro-structure can be in array spacings distribution or random distribution or continuously distributed.Micro-structure 3 is formed using photoresist.
It please refers to shown in Fig. 9~Figure 10, one of 3rd embodiment of the utility model decorating film 4, it is real with first The difference for applying example is that the micro-structure 41 in the present embodiment in decorating film is set to the first surface of substrate layer 42, is rendered as recessed Fall into structure.The structure of micro-structure 41 is rectangle with the micro-structure in embodiment one, one end surface shape of micro-structure, and other end is arc Shape curved surface.
In addition, an end face of micro-structure is polygon, other end is arc-shaped curved surface, and the peripheral part and arc of polygon are bent The peripheral part in face is around connection, and wherein polygon is in addition to being triangle and rectangle, can also be trapezoidal, pentagon or hexagon, But not limited to this, when polygon is pentagon, the form of arc-shaped curved surface indent can be showed.
The utility model embodiment additionally provides a kind of electronic equipment cover board, including the decorating film, can form cone The effect of shadow of shape, while the shadow presented has frosted finish effect.So that color is more gorgeous changeable and agile full, thus shape At visual effect abundant, reach good decorative effect and aesthetics.
